Challenges with social communication and interaction are a defining characteristic of autism spectrum disorder (ASD). These challenges frequently interfere making friendships, securing maintaining employment, can lead to co-occurring conditions. While face-to-face clinical interventions trained professionals be helpful in improving conversation, they costly unavailable many, particularly given the high prevalence ASD lack professional training. The purpose this study was assess whether an AI program using Large Language Model (LLM) would improve verbal empathetic responses during conversation. Autistic adolescents adults, 11–35 years age, who were able engage conversation but demonstrated participated study. A randomized trial design used effects (Noora) compared waitlist control group. Noora asks participants respond leading statements provides feedback on their answers. In study, asked 10 per day 5 days week for 4 weeks expected total 200 trials. Pre- post-intervention samples collected generalization natural Additionally pre- questionnaires regarding each participant's comfort participants' satisfaction collected. results that could greatly improved by short period time. Participants experimental group showed statistically significant improvements responses, which generalized Some reported confidence targeted areas most levels program. findings suggest LLMs thereby providing time- cost-efficient support autistic adults.
